raise Error('The casa commands log is not executable!') # This file contains CASA commands run by the pipeline. Although all commands # required to calibrate the data are included here, this file cannot be # executed, nor does it contain heuristic and flagging calculations performed # by pipeline code. This file is useful to understand which CASA commands are # being run by each pipeline task. If one wishes to re-run the pipeline, one # should use the pipeline script linked on the front page or By Task page of # the weblog.
